Liverpool’s summer spending has almost reached the £300 million ($406 million) mark following the latest addition of striker Hugo Ekitiké.
The Reds were eager to boost in the centre forward department. But, after a brief flirtation with Alexander Isak—a deal that could yet be reignited, Liverpool splashed £79 million ($106.9 million) on Ekitiké.
The 23-year-old enjoyed an exceptional season at Eintracht Frankfurt in 2024–25 and will now have the opportunity to prove himself in the Premier League. Liverpool supporters will be desperate to earn their first glimpse, which could come on Saturday during a pre-season friendly against AC Milan.
However, Ekitiké will be wearing a temporary shirt number on his back should he make his unofficial debut against the Italians this weekend.
